Output 3fa0190a554a63fdacf44058de55a44337603c44f501760d119c74add0243654:0

value
23466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 890e8f901f84851721479010a0e5e89fd5f84b27 OP_EQUAL
address
3EBhwXUDRpoWhgCRQvtkHebNHRVJ826jgM
transaction
3fa0190a554a63fdacf44058de55a44337603c44f501760d119c74add0243654
spent
true